Wednesday, July 4, 2018 - PNP into Zalto Burgundy glass ("Flower" day): Purplish ruby to the eyes.

Elegant nose of vegetal notes like green bell pepper, earthy, roasted herbs aromas coupled with darker juicy fruits like cherries and plums. Very good definition to the aromas overall.

Has the flavours to match the aromas on the palate too. Good amount of minerality and acidity that provided the grip. Tannins are silky and a little dusty towards the finish. Good focus on the finish.

Enjoyable. 92-93 points.

1-hour upon opening (“Flower” to “Leaf”): more sour cherry / salt-preserved plums flavours emerged. (Somehow this reminds me of similar flavours found in the Pierre Overnoy Chardonnays tasted before...) Fine-boned acidity and minerality with tannins even better integrated. 93 points.

12-hours upon opening (“Leaf” to “Flower”): continued to impress with bright black cherry and cassis fruits on nose followed through nicely on palate. From first instance till now, this wine has this thirst-quenching ability that I would not normally associate with Cabernet Francs that is most impressive. Retain at 93 points.
